Subject: [PATCH v2 3/8] hw/pci/pci_bridge: Correct pci_bridge_io memory region size
Date: Mon,  1 Jun 2020 16:29:25 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200601142930.29408-4-f4bug@amsat.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200601142930.29408-1-f4bug@amsat.org>

memory_region_set_size() handle the 16 Exabytes limit by
special-casing the UINT64_MAX value. This is not a problem
for the 32-bit maximum, 4 GiB.
By using the UINT32_MAX value, the pci_bridge_io MemoryRegion
ends up missing 1 byte:

  (qemu) info mtree
  memory-region: pci_bridge_io
    0000000000000000-00000000fffffffe (prio 0, i/o): pci_bridge_io
      0000000000000060-0000000000000060 (prio 0, i/o): i8042-data
      0000000000000064-0000000000000064 (prio 0, i/o): i8042-cmd
      00000000000001ce-00000000000001d1 (prio 0, i/o): vbe
      0000000000000378-000000000000037f (prio 0, i/o): parallel
      00000000000003b4-00000000000003b5 (prio 0, i/o): vga
      ...

Fix by using the correct value. We now have:

  memory-region: pci_bridge_io
    0000000000000000-00000000ffffffff (prio 0, i/o): pci_bridge_io
      0000000000000060-0000000000000060 (prio 0, i/o): i8042-data
      0000000000000064-0000000000000064 (prio 0, i/o): i8042-cmd
      ...

Reviewed-by: Peter Maydell <peter.maydell@linaro.org>
Signed-off-by: Philippe Mathieu-Daudé <f4bug@amsat.org>
---
 hw/pci/pci_bridge.c | 3 ++-
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/hw/pci/pci_bridge.c b/hw/pci/pci_bridge.c
index 97967d12eb..3ba3203f72 100644
--- a/hw/pci/pci_bridge.c
+++ b/hw/pci/pci_bridge.c
@@ -30,6 +30,7 @@
  */
 
 #include "qemu/osdep.h"
+#include "qemu/units.h"
 #include "hw/pci/pci_bridge.h"
 #include "hw/pci/pci_bus.h"
 #include "qemu/module.h"
@@ -381,7 +382,7 @@ void pci_bridge_initfn(PCIDevice *dev, const char *typename)
     memory_region_init(&br->address_space_mem, OBJECT(br), "pci_bridge_pci", UINT64_MAX);
     sec_bus->address_space_io = &br->address_space_io;
     memory_region_init(&br->address_space_io, OBJECT(br), "pci_bridge_io",
-                       UINT32_MAX);
+                       4 * GiB);
     br->windows = pci_bridge_region_init(br);
     QLIST_INIT(&sec_bus->child);
     QLIST_INSERT_HEAD(&parent->child, sec_bus, sibling);
